4. CD Archiving (Red Book)
Sound Forge 4.5 was one of the first tools to allow home users to burn Red Book compliant audio CDs via third-party SCSI burners (like the Yamaha CDR-series). You could set track indexes (pauses of 2 seconds), adjust pre-emphasis, and write PQ codes directly to a CD-R. That capability turned bedrooms into mastering studios. sound forge 4.5
Installation and System Requirements: A Breath of Fresh Air
Compared to modern bloated installers, Sound Forge 4.5 shipped on a single CD-ROM (or three floppy disks). The requirements were shockingly modest: Sound Forge 4
- CPU: Intel Pentium 90 MHz (Pentium 166 recommended)
- OS: Windows 95 or Windows NT 4.0
- RAM: 16 MB (32 MB recommended)
- Hard Drive: 20 MB for installation
- Sound Card: Any Windows MME (Multimedia Extensions) compatible card.

The Evolution: From Sonic Foundry to Magix
It is important to trace the lineage. Sonic Foundry sold the Sound Forge line to Sony in 2003. Sony's versions (6.0 through 10.0) added CD Architect integration and video editing. In 2016, Magix acquired the line. The modern Sound Forge Pro 18 is a beast: it handles 64-bit, 384 kHz audio, has spectral layering, and integrates with Izotope RX.
But many old-timers argue that versions 4.5 through 5.0 had the tightest, most stable code base. Once Sony added DVD burning and video tracks, the bloat began. Example practical tasks (with concise commands)
- Trim silence: select region > Edit > Trim
- Normalize to -1 dB: Process > Normalize > set target -1.0 dB
- Remove clicks: Tools > Click/Pop Removal > preview & apply
- Batch convert folder to 16-bit WAV: Tools > Batch Converter > add folder > set output format > Start
